Detectives are investigating after four masked men attacked a house in Larne with what was described as sledgehammers.
It happened in the Moyle Parade area of the town shortly after midnight.
Damage was caused to windows and doors and to the inside of the property.
There was no-one inside the house at the time.
Detective Sergeant Robinson said, "We are working to establish a motive for the attack and would appeal to anyone with information, or who witnessed what happened, to call us on the non emergency number 101, quoting reference number 9 of 03/06/19."
